Brittany Jayne Furlan (born September 5, 1986) is an American internet personality based in Los Angeles, who was the most followed female video star on Vine until November 2015 when she left Vine.
She was declared by Time in 2015 to be one of the most influential people on the internet.[2]
Early life
Furlan was born on September 5, 1986 in Perkasie, Pennsylvania, U.S. to Italian-American parents.
Furlan previously tried to break into TV before becoming a star on Vine. She is developing a sketch comedy show produced by Seth Green[3] and signed with content network Endemol.[4]
Furlan also appeared in the music video for the song "Fireball" by Pitbull featuring John Ryan.
Furlan was embroiled in a controversy during the 2014 Daytime Emmys Red Carpet show when she told actor Ryan Paevey, "We're going to get you away from us before we rape you."[5]
Personal life
Since early 2017, Furlan has been in a relationship with former Mötley Crüe drummer, Tommy Lee. On February 14, 2018, they announced their engagement on Instagram.[6]
